The global clinical trials matching software market size was valued at USD 148.3 Million in 2022 and is likely to reach USD 441.96 Million by 2031, expanding at a CAGR of 12.9% during 2023 – 2031. The market growth is attributed to the growing healthcare sector and increasing number of clinical trials.
Increasing number of clinical trials is expected to boost the demand for clinical trials matching software. This matching software helps patients or volunteers to identify clinical trials that the patients are eligible for by comparing patient characteristics against the eligibility criteria of available trials. It also stores and processes the patient's medical data, which enhances its adoption in clinical trials. Therefore, rising clinical trials worldwide are propelling the market. For instance,
According to a report published by the National Library of Medicine, 38,030 clinical trials were performed in 2022.
The demand for clinical trial matching software is rapidly increasing in biotechnology, CROs, and medical device companies, as it allows for planning, tracking, and analyzing clinical trials. It also provides transparency and unified access to study information, which helps the study team to make sound decisions. This increases the demand for clinical trial matching software in healthcare.

The integration of artificial intelligence in healthcare creates an immense opportunity in the market. AI-powered clinical trial matching software helps scientists and researchers automate data analysis, optimize patient recruitment, and enhance safety monitoring. AI-enabled matching software assists companies and research institutes in patient selection, monitoring patients, and cohort composition. AI in clinical trial matching software improves efficiency and decreases waste. Moreover, research institutes and key companies in the market are developing and launching AI-based clinical trial matching platforms, which creates a lucrative opportunity in the market. For instance,
On September 14, 2023, Belong. Life, a global health tech provider of high-engagement patient communities and care platforms, announced the launch of Tara, an artificial intelligence (AI) cancer clinical trial matching platform. Tara is a software as a service (SaaS) that is available to hospitals, health systems, and contract research organizations (CROs).

Based on deployment mode, the clinical trials matching software market is bifurcated into web & cloud-based and on-premises. The web & cloud-based segment dominated the market in 2022, owing to its ability to offer high accessibility and quick deployment. Cloud-based clinical trial matching software has centralized data security that reduces operating expenses and provides instant trial insights, enhancing its demand for clinical trials. It also allows collaboration on different projects and makes data sharing convenient, which increases its adoption in clinical trials.

On December 14, 2021, Optimapharm a key Europe-based, mid-sized, full-service Clinical Research Organization (CRO) announced the acquisition of SSS International Clinical Research (SSS) to strengthen its presence in the market in Western and Northern Europe and expand its in-house capabilities, for the benefit of its biopharmaceutical clients worldwide.
On April 6, 2020, IQVIA Inc., a global provider of advanced analytics, technology solutions, and clinical research services to the life sciences industry, announced the launch of the Trial Matching Tool, the world’s first online platform that matches individuals with specific COVID-19 studies to accelerate clinical research projects.
